      Current management approach to hidradenocarcinoma: a comprehensive review of the literature

          Abstract

          Hidradenocarcinoma is a rare malignant adnexal tumour which arises from the intradermal duct of eccrine sweat glands. The head and neck are the most common sites of hidradenocarcinoma, but rarely it can occur on the extremities. As it is an aggressive tumour, regional lymph nodes and distant viscera are the most common sites of metastasis. Diagnosis is confirmed by histopathology and immunohistochemistry. Hidradenocarcinoma should be differentiated from benign and malignant adnexal tumours. Being an aggressive and rare tumour, no uniform treatment guidelines have been documented so far for metastatic hidradenocarcinoma. Wide local excision is the mainstay of the treatment, but because of high local recurrence, radiotherapy in a dose of 50Gy–70Gy and/or 5-fluorouracil and capecitabine-based combination chemotherapy may be given to further improve local control. Other treatment strategies are targeted therapies like trastuzumab, EGFR inhibitors, PI3K/Akt/mTOR pathway inhibitors, hormonal agents like antiandrogens, electrochemotherapy, or clinical trials.

          Skin adnexal neoplasms--part 2: an approach to tumours of cutaneous sweat glands.

          Tumours of cutaneous sweat glands are uncommon, with a wide histological spectrum, complex classification and many different terms often used to describe the same tumour. Furthermore, many eccrine/apocrine lesions coexist within hamartomas or within lesions with composite/mixed differentiation. In addition to the eccrine and apocrine glands, two other skin sweat glands have recently been described: the apoeccrine and the mammary-like glands of the anogenital area. In this review (the second of two articles on skin adnexal neoplasms), common as well as important benign and malignant lesions of cutaneous sweat glands are described, and a summary for differentiating primary adnexal neoplasms from metastatic carcinoma is outlined, striving to maintain a common and acceptable terminology in this complex subject. Composite/mixed adnexal tumours are also discussed briefly.

            Eccrine adenocarcinoma. A clinicopathologic study of 35 cases.

            A clinicopathologic study was made of 35 patients with primary eccrine adenocarcinoma diagnosed in the past 20 years from among 450,000 consecutive skin biopsy specimens. Histologically the following four distinct variants were identified: eccrine porocarcinoma (18 cases), syringoid eccrine carcinoma (12 cases), mucinous eccrine carcinoma (three cases), and clear cell eccrine carcinoma (two cases). Overall, eccrine adenocarcinomas are destructive lesions with a tendency to local recurrence. The syringoid histologic variant appears to be well differentiated and may have a benign clinical course; the lesion remained localized to the skin in our 12 cases. Regional lymphatic and distant metastasis, however, occurred in two patients with eccrine porocarcinoma.

              Eccrine porocarcinoma: clinical and pathological studies of 12 cases.

              Twelve cases of eccrine porocarcinoma have been reported at our facility in the past 10 years. All of them were Japanese; half had lymph node metastases; and one-third died of this disease. Lymph node metastasis was correlated with pathological lymphovascular invasion. Death was correlated with a pathological growth pattern and clinical lymph node metastasis. Sentinel lymph node biopsy was performed usefully in two patients.
